251500666317097 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 251500666317098. Its totient is φ = 251500666317096.
The previous prime is 251500666317049. The next prime is 251500666317127. The reversal of 251500666317097 is 790713666005152.
251500666317097 is digitally balanced in base 2, because in such base it contains all the possibile digits an equal number of times.
It is a strong prime.
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 250472056563481 + 1028609753616 = 15826309^2 + 1014204^2 .
It is a cyclic number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 251500666317097 - 211 = 251500666315049 is a prime.
It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(251500666317007)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 125750333158548 + 125750333158549.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(125750333158549).
Almost surely, 2251500666317097 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
251500666317097 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).
251500666317097 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.
251500666317097 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 14288400, while the sum is 58.
